Bright red and youthful in the glass. Lifted aromas of blackberry, dark cherry, Asian spice, dried herbs, bramble and violets. Bright, mouth-filling, firm and layered. Full of plush dark fruits, grippy, grainy tannin and perky acidity. This has real life, spark and purity and will cellar for many years to come. Drink 2025–2040.
95 points Aaron Brasher for The Real Review, July 2025
The 2023 Cabernets, a blend of all five Bordeaux varieties, is well built, offering a complex array of aromas to start: blackberry and licorice lifted by gravel, cedar and a touch of cigar box. The palate is mid weight, with a lattice of firm tannins providing a strong base to gravelly tones lifted by violet whispers. Unique and likely to build nicely over the next decade. Drink 2027–2036.
92 points Angus Hughson for Vinous, January 2026
The 2023 Cabernets comprises a blend of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Petit Verdot, Malbec and Cabernet Franc, and the wine leads with a nose of green herbs, dark berry fruits, licorice, cocoa and freshly turned earth/bramble. In the mouth, the wine is medium-bodied and structural, with a creamy middle palate and finely structured finish. There are notes of graphite and lead pencil to close. This is a nice wine, from a great vintage. Drink 2025–2033.
91 points Erin Larkin for The Wine Advocate, January 2026
Voyager Estate was established in 1978 on the gravelly soils of Stevens Valley in southern Margaret River, one of the coolest and most maritime-influenced parts of the region. The estate has been farming organically since 2017 and received full certification in 2023. All fruit is estate grown across five vineyards on granite and ironstone soils.
This is a true Bordeaux blend where Cabernet Sauvignon leads at 54% with a substantial 37% of Merlot alongside smaller amounts of Petit Verdot, Malbec and Cabernet Franc. Each variety is fermented separately on wild yeasts before blending, then nine months in French oak with just 10% new. Winemaker Tim Shand prefers fruit picked on the fresher side, focusing on detail and drive rather than ripeness and weight.
The 2023 season was outstanding. Warm days with cool evenings preserving acidity and a late harvest under clear skies delivering excellent flavour development.
Vibrant ruby, the nose is perfumed and inviting with aromas of plum, mulberry, cherry, pepper and clove spice. The palate is juicy and generous with velvety tannins and a subtly spiced oak finish. Elegant, composed and delicious.
Try with slow-roasted lamb, Korean braised short ribs or a ragu with good pasta.
Drink now through 2033.
